I'm not sure how to logically go from "only 79 likes on facebook" to "congress doesn't feel any pressure" to "congress will welcome the change". And I tend to agree with the people who ignore the topic: my basic position is that where markets are functioning, we don't need government involvement in the first place. And the reverse - where the government has decided to control something, it's because they believe markets are not able to deliver results they like.
